Ministry of Environmental Health Perform Fogging Exercise in Grand Bahama
In a proactive move, the Ministry of Environmental Health Officials in Grand Bahama fogged in the Eight Mile Rock Community about 4:30 am Wednesday, August 17 against the Aedes Aegypti mosquito that transmits Dengue fever. Pictured is Julian Bethel, Environment officer fogging.

Grand Bahama Status Report After Hurricane Matthew
Grand Bahama Status Report After Hurricane Matthew
Hurricane Matthew aggressively moved throughout Grand Bahama Island on Thursday, October 7th, 2016, with hurricane force winds in excess of 150 mph; damaging much of the residences and infrastructure on the southern shoreline, from East to West End. The storm brought Grand Bahama Island to a standstill, crippling business and commerce, with devastation impacting the daily lives of all residents. T...

Environment Minister says every effort being made to protect livelihood of residents in area affected by oil slick
Minister with responsibility for the Environment and Natural Resources and the acting Minister for Transport and Housing, Vaughn Miller says every effort is being made to protect the lives and livelihoods of residents in the immediate communities where an oil slick was reported two days ago, namely residents in Pinder’s Point, North Bahamia, Hunters and Grand Bahama in general.

Govt to probe offloading of beetle-infested wood in GB
THE Bahamas Government has launched an investigation into the offloading of wood reportedly infested with an invasive beetle by a Panama-registered cargo vessel at Grand Bahama last week.
